1、适合清除几个公式–粘贴为值;
2.适用于大量公式的快速清除–宏命令
2.1.新建一张工作表,按ALT+F11调出宏命令界面。在宏命令界面,按F7键调出代码窗口,将下面的代码***粘贴到代码区。
子宏1()
将sh显示为工作表
对于每张纸上的sh
先令UsedRange = sh。使用范围.值
然后
末端接头
2.2.粘贴完成后,关闭代码窗口和宏命令界面,将工作簿保存为“清除公式,只保留值。xl***”。请注意选择“启用宏的Excel工作簿”作为保存类型。
2.3.打开我们需要清除公式的表,然后打开我们的宏表“清除公式只保留值。xl***”,
2.4.请注意,我的示例截图的公式是相同的,但是对于E列数据,我修改了单元格格式以保留两位小数。
之所以这样,是想提醒广大朋友,清楚完格式后,如果单元格格式提前进行了设置,比如我这样,所呈现的数据会与单元格格式相符合,而不会出现多位小数,对数据要求精确的朋友请务必留意。之所以这样做,是为了提醒朋友们,如果格式明确后,事先设置好单元格格式,比如我的,那么呈现的数据就会和单元格格式一致,不会出现多位小数的情况。要求数据准确的请注意。
2.5.打开示例表后,按ALT+F8启用宏。如果在弹出的宏窗口中列表为空,如图所示,
请将下面“位置”选项卡中的“当前工作簿”替换为“所有打开的工作簿”,这样我们刚才保存的宏命令就会出现在上面的宏列表区域,
2.6.我们点击执行。执行完成后,我们可以看到所有的公式都被清除了,只保留了值。
我们也注意到,E列的数据还是2位小数位,而其他列的数据都是多位小数位,这就是上面提到的单元格格式的问题。
2.7.测试后,隐藏很深的工作表中的公式也会被清除。
本文来自是我太自作多情投稿,不代表舒华文档立场,如若转载,请注明出处:https://www.chinashuhua.cn/24/566034.html